На вход программы поступает неизвестное количество чисел целых, ввод заканчивается нулём. Определить, сколько получено чисел, которые оканчиваются на 6.

daridolgova daridolgova    3   10.02.2021 19:11    2

Ответы
troll28 troll28  10.02.2021 19:20

numbers = 0

while True:

number = input()

if number == '0':

 break

if number[-1] == '6':

 numbers += 1

print(numbers)

Объяснение:

Можно реализовать с строк. Да, можно вводить числа, но всё равно их после придётся форматировать в строку.

ПОКАЗАТЬ ОТВЕТЫ
Другие вопросы по теме Информатика